6. At all meetings <strong>of</strong> the Council the Master, or in his or her<br />
absence the Vice-Master or in his or her absence the most<br />
senior Fellow present who is able and willing to act, shall<br />
preside. It shall be the duty <strong>of</strong> the Master to ensure that<br />
minutes are made <strong>of</strong> every meeting <strong>of</strong> the Council; the custody<br />
<strong>of</strong> the Minute Book shall be determined by the Master and it<br />
shall be accessible to members <strong>of</strong> the Governing Body at all<br />
reasonable times.<br />
7. The Governing Body may at a <strong>College</strong> meeting specially<br />
summoned for the purpose, by a vote in which not less than<br />
two-thirds <strong>of</strong> its whole number concur, excluding any Fellow on<br />
leave <strong>of</strong> absence, annul any resolution <strong>of</strong> the Council. The<br />
Governing Body may in like manner dissolve the Council and<br />
resume the powers delegated thereto by virtue <strong>of</strong> this Statute.<br />
